My Background and Approach

Prior to making a mid-career change to the field of marriage and family therapy nine years ago, I worked as a marketing and public relations executive for almost 20 years in the high tech industry in California. This experience taught me a lot about working with clients from very diverse cultural backgrounds and professional identities. It also gave me an opportunity to witness firsthand the stress and other negative effects of ‘corporate America’ and in conforming to social norms and pressures that don’t fit our own ideas of self. Born in India and raised in the US since the age of three, I have also lived and worked in the Dominican Republic and Japan. I am part of a multi-cultural and multi-lingual family. I believe this gives me a unique perspective on how individuals, couples and families deal with the stressors associated with immigration and acculturation, multi-ethnic relationships, intergenerational conflicts, life transitions and other difficulties.

My Personal Beliefs and Interests

My therapy approach is client-centered, compassionate, honoring of your values and lived experiences, and focused on the changes you would like to make in your life. I draw from Narrative Therapy practices and Solution-Focused principles to support you in re-writing your personal story and overcoming the challenges that keep you feeling stuck. I also recognize that many of the hardships that clients face are the result of systemic racism, injustice and inequity, which can manifest in a host of mental health concerns including anxiety, depression and violence. These are not flaws in a person's character but the negative effects of a society that privileges the rights, desires and dominance of certain people over others.
